CID final probe report says Chhatra League leader Diaz died by suicide

The Criminal Investigation Department (CID) on Thursday submitted its final probe report on Diaz Irfan Chowdhury's murder case, saying the Chhatra League leader had committed suicide. 

The investigating officer of the case, Assistant Superintendent of Police (ASP) of Chittagong CID Abdus Salam Mia, submitted the report to District Court Inspector Zakir Hossain Mahmud six years after the death of Diaz. 

Zakir Hossain Mahmud said the report will be submitted to the court on Sunday. 

Diaz's elder sister, Jubaida Sarwar Chowdhury Nipa, said they did not know about the report submission. 

“The accused of the case knew about the submission before us. They posted a status on Facebook, through which we came to know about it. The police did not speak to us before filing the final report,” she said. 

“We will protest the report and ask the court to task another agency to probe into the incident,” she added. 

On November 20, 2016, the body of Diaz was found hanging from the ceiling of his room near Chittagong University. 

Diaz was a former joint secretary of the Chittagong University unit of Chhatra League and assistant secretary of its central committee.

Four days later, Diaz's mother filed a murder case against 10 named and 10 unnamed persons.

Although a first autopsy conducted at Chittagong Medical College Hospital had concluded that he had committed suicide by hanging himself, a second autopsy at Dhaka Medical College Hospital determined that he had been murdered by strangulation.

Diaz's family and associates in Chhatra League claimed he had been murdered by his rivals over tender manipulation.
